For the 2024 school year, there are 8 private preschools serving 3,004 students in 98011, WA.
The top ranked private preschools in 98011, WA include Cedar Park Christian Schools, Heritage Christian Academy and Providence Classical Christian School.
The average acceptance rate is 98%, which is higher than the Washington private preschool average acceptance rate of 87%.
50% of private preschools in 98011, WA are religiously affiliated (most commonly Catholic and Assembly of God).
